Hudson Offering 'Aqua Forest' and Other Titles for Free



iPhone developer Hudson is giving away three of its iPhone games this week as a promotion for the Tokyo Game Show 2008.

The free games include:

Aqua Forest ($7.99 -> Free) - particle-based physics game
Catch The Egg ($3.99 -> Free) - accelerometer-based game to catch a falling egg
NeoSameGame ($3.99 -> Free) - puzzle game

The promotion ends October 12th, so get them while you can.
